    A homeless man stole an unmarked Miami Beach police car in South Beach on Sunday night, police say. He sped south on Meridian Avenue, striking cars parked on the east and west sides of the street, before losing control of the vehicle at 13th Street and Meridian Avenue, according to an arrest report released Monday.The suspect, 25-year-old Leon Daybrell Perrymond, was taken into custody and charged with third-degree grand theft of a vehicle, aggravated battery of an officer, fleeing police lights

    2 Belgian Officers Killed in Terror Attack
    Embed from Getty ImagesA man has shot dead two female police officers and a civilian in the eastern Belgian city of Liège.Reports say the man attacked the officers from behind with a knife, then took a service weapon from them and shot them both. He also killed a man sitting in a parked car.The gunman also took a female cleaner hostage at a school before being killed by police.
